I have noticed this statement by HX on their website.Allowing for Human Error
In the BPA's statement, mention is made to the possibility of a parking charge notice (PCN) being issued as a result of human error, saying we do recognise that errors can occur and they can be upsetting for the motorist.
In many cases, parking tickets are cancelled by the operator when they are given additional information, said the BPA.
We can confirm that, with HX Car Park Management, this is absolutely the case. Not only that, but in every instance of a PCN being issued, we will actively assess the possibility of human error. To this end, if the number plate entered by the motorist displays up to two characters difference from the number plate of the vehicle in question, we will automatically dismiss the case as human error and recall the relevant parking charge.

I would ask Gladstones to send you the paper copies of the Information Sheet and Reply Form that they should have included with the LBC as required as per Paragraph 3.1 (c) of the Pre Action Protocol..
On the reply form you ask for copies of all the documents you require. I would definitely ask for an unredacted copy of the contract that HX have with the landowner that shows they the authority to take legal action. Also a full copy of the ANPR log for the day the keeper's vehicle was there.0 -
